JAIL INMATES ALLOWED TO PERFORM THE LAST RITES OF THE FATHER WHO DIED IN JAIL DUE TO CARDIAC ARREST

Ferozepur (Vikramditya Sharma)

Two jail inmates, who were booked in a murder case last year, were allowed to perform the last rites of their father under police escort at the expense of the State. It is pertinent to mention here that their father was also lodged in the central jail and had died due to cardiac arrest on June 9.

As per information, the jail inmate Gurdev Singh son of Santa Singh, a resident of Village Chakk Panje Ke in Guruharsahai sub-division had passed away due to heart attack on Thursday. Gurdev was booked in a murder case under sections 302, 307, 323, 341, 148 and 149 IPC (FIR No. 44 Dated 14.04.2021) at Guruharsahai police station along with his two sons Sukhminder Singh and Balwinder Singh.

(SUBHEAD)While divulging more details Ekta Uppal, Chief Judicial Magistrate said that both Sukhminder and Balwinder had no money to pay the escort charges.“They had no money to pay the police escort charges to perform the last rites of their father. They had submitted an application in my court following which they were allowed to perform the last rites of their father and were provided the police escort without any charges.

Advocate Gagan Goklani said that following the instructions of the CJM, an application was submitted in the court of officiating session judge. “The officiating sessions judge asked for the file from the concerned court and instructed the jail superintendent to allow Sukhminder and Balwinder to perform the last rites of their father”, he said.
